- MacDonell, Allan (1808-1888) [détails]. The North-West Transportation, Navigation and Railway Company: Its objects. Toronto : Printed by order of the Board, by Lovell & Gibson, 1858.
- Description matérielle : 55 p.; 21 cm.
- Langue : anglais
- Appendix on pages [29]-54 contains Peel 281, as well as the eighth report (1851) of the Standing Committee on Railways and Telegraph Lines. MacDonell showed, on paper at least, that a railway would derive a lucrative revenue by exporting buffalo tallow and tongues from the western plains. A railway from Lake Superior would re-route the trade carried by cart between Red River Settlement and St Paul. The Company was incorporated by the Legislature of Canada in 1858. Also published, [New Haven, Conn.: Research Publications, 196-?] (55p.).
